Battle Ground is a town in Tippecanoe Township, Tippecanoe County in the U.S. state of Indiana. The population was 1,838 at the 2020 census. It is near the site of the Battle of Tippecanoe.

Battle Ground is part of the Lafayette, Indiana, Metropolitan Statistical Area.
